Rational Kernels for Arabic Stemming and Text Classification
In this paper, we address the problems of Arabic Text Classification and stemming using Transducers and Rational Kernels. We introduce a new stemming technique based on the use of Arabic patterns (Pattern Based Stemmer). Patterns are modelled using transducers and stemming is done without depending on any dictionary. متن کاملText Classification using String Kernels
We propose a novel approach for categorizing text documents based on the use of a special kernel. The kernel is an inner product in the feature space generated by all subsequences of length k. A subsequence is any ordered sequence of k characters occurring in the text though not necessarily contiguously.
